What is a Social Media Engagement Coordinator?

Similar Job Titles:

Social Media Specialist, Community Manager, Social Media Strategist, Social Media Coordinator

A Social Media Engagement Coordinator is a person who monitors a company’s social media platforms, creates engaging content, and actively interacts with online communities to enhance brand visibility and customer relationships. They ensure a positive and engaging experience across various platforms.

A Social Media Engagement Coordinator is not:

A Graphic Designer

A Graphic Designer is responsible for creating visual content to communicate messages. While a Social Media Engagement Coordinator may work closely with a Graphic Designer to create engaging content, they generally do not handle the actual design work.

A Public Relations Specialist

A Public Relations Specialist focuses on maintaining a positive public image for an organization through media releases, public relations programs, and fundraising. They typically focus on a broader range of media and stakeholder relations.

Social Media Engagement Coordinators are commonly evaluated based on engagement, growth, and content performance. Simplified, common metrics cover:

  • Engagement rates
  • Audience growth rates
  • Conversion rates
  • Response times
  • Brand sentiments

Social Media Engagement Coordinator Salary

US Based, employer-reported data for a Social Media Engagement Coordinator:

  • 25th Percentile $44.3K
  • Average $55.5K
  • 75th Percentile $60.2K
